  • Joshua 14:6-15
    Then the children of Judah came to Joshua in Gilgal. And Caleb the son of Jephunneh the Kenizzite said to him:“ You know the word which the Lord said to Moses the man of God concerning you and me in Kadesh Barnea.I was forty years old when Moses the servant of the Lord sent me from Kadesh Barnea to spy out the land, and I brought back word to him as it was in my heart.Nevertheless my brethren who went up with me made the heart of the people melt, but I wholly followed the Lord my God.So Moses swore on that day, saying,‘ Surely the land where your foot has trodden shall be your inheritance and your children’s forever, because you have wholly followed the Lord my God.’And now, behold, the Lord has kept me alive, as He said, these forty-five years, ever since the Lord spoke this word to Moses while Israel wandered in the wilderness; and now, here I am this day, eighty-five years old.As yet I am as strong this day as on the day that Moses sent me; just as my strength was then, so now is my strength for war, both for going out and for coming in.Now therefore, give me this mountain of which the Lord spoke in that day; for you heard in that day how the Anakim were there, and that the cities were great and fortified. It may be that the Lord will be with me, and I shall be able to drive them out as the Lord said.”And Joshua blessed him, and gave Hebron to Caleb the son of Jephunneh as an inheritance.Hebron therefore became the inheritance of Caleb the son of Jephunneh the Kenizzite to this day, because he wholly followed the Lord God of Israel.And the name of Hebron formerly was Kirjath Arba( Arba was the greatest man among the Anakim). Then the land had rest from war.

  • Joshua 15:13-19
    Now to Caleb the son of Jephunneh he gave a share among the children of Judah, according to the commandment of the Lord to Joshua, namely, Kirjath Arba, which is Hebron( Arba was the father of Anak).Caleb drove out the three sons of Anak from there: Sheshai, Ahiman, and Talmai, the children of Anak.Then he went up from there to the inhabitants of Debir( formerly the name of Debir was Kirjath Sepher).And Caleb said,“ He who attacks Kirjath Sepher and takes it, to him I will give Achsah my daughter as wife.”So Othniel the son of Kenaz, the brother of Caleb, took it; and he gave him Achsah his daughter as wife.Now it was so, when she came to him, that she persuaded him to ask her father for a field. So she dismounted from her donkey, and Caleb said to her,“ What do you wish?”She answered,“ Give me a blessing; since you have given me land in the South, give me also springs of water.” So he gave her the upper springs and the lower springs.
